summaryrefslogtreecommitdiff
path: root/tests/urlpatterns_reverse
diff options
context:
space:
mode:
authorClifford Gama <cliffygamy@gmail.com>2024-10-22 14:12:02 +0200
committerSarah Boyce <42296566+sarahboyce@users.noreply.github.com>2024-10-23 15:37:54 +0200
commit4d11ea1ef01eba14b3a48a727f07f723f782fd84 (patch)
tree639f71cfd06d0655ec79d6d32dc0fdc21b340265 /tests/urlpatterns_reverse
parentbe138f32ed32a4bf3e62305145423285e462c853 (diff)
Fixed #28999 -- Documented how to reverse a class-based view by instance.
Co-authored-by: Sarah Boyce <42296566+sarahboyce@users.noreply.github.com>
Diffstat (limited to 'tests/urlpatterns_reverse')
-rw-r--r--tests/urlpatterns_reverse/tests.py4
-rw-r--r--tests/urlpatterns_reverse/urls.py2
-rw-r--r--tests/urlpatterns_reverse/views.py4
3 files changed, 5 insertions, 5 deletions
diff --git a/tests/urlpatterns_reverse/tests.py b/tests/urlpatterns_reverse/tests.py
index 216545b5f5..91d3f237ec 100644
--- a/tests/urlpatterns_reverse/tests.py
+++ b/tests/urlpatterns_reverse/tests.py
@@ -522,12 +522,12 @@ class URLPatternReverse(SimpleTestCase):
with self.assertRaisesMessage(NoReverseMatch, msg):
reverse("places", kwargs={"arg1": 2})
- def test_func_view_from_cbv(self):
+ def test_view_func_from_cbv(self):
expected = "/hello/world/"
url = reverse(views.view_func_from_cbv, kwargs={"name": "world"})
self.assertEqual(url, expected)
- def test_func_view_from_cbv_no_expected_kwarg(self):
+ def test_view_func_from_cbv_no_expected_kwarg(self):
with self.assertRaises(NoReverseMatch):
reverse(views.view_func_from_cbv)
diff --git a/tests/urlpatterns_reverse/urls.py b/tests/urlpatterns_reverse/urls.py
index 5bf20a3f63..aca2d06ef7 100644
--- a/tests/urlpatterns_reverse/urls.py
+++ b/tests/urlpatterns_reverse/urls.py
@@ -137,6 +137,6 @@ urlpatterns = [
path("includes/", include(other_patterns)),
# Security tests
re_path("(.+)/security/$", empty_view, name="security"),
- # View function from cbv
+ # View function from cbv.
path("hello/<slug:name>/", view_func_from_cbv),
]
diff --git a/tests/urlpatterns_reverse/views.py b/tests/urlpatterns_reverse/views.py
index aa55917ec0..01dfc1309e 100644
--- a/tests/urlpatterns_reverse/views.py
+++ b/tests/urlpatterns_reverse/views.py
@@ -58,12 +58,12 @@ def bad_view(request, *args, **kwargs):
raise ValueError("I don't think I'm getting good value for this view")
-class _HelloView(View):
+class HelloView(View):
def get(self, request, *args, **kwargs):
return HttpResponse(f"Hello {self.kwargs['name']}")
-view_func_from_cbv = _HelloView.as_view()
+view_func_from_cbv = HelloView.as_view()
empty_view_partial = partial(empty_view, template_name="template.html")
empty_view_nested_partial = partial(